Abstract: | This is a print of Paul Gaugin's Women of Tahiti which shows two women in dresses sitting on the ground with an abstract background. There is an artist's signature in the bottom right of the print. Below the print in the bottom left reads ""WOMEN OF TAHITI" by GAUGUIN", center reading "LOUVE, PARIS", and in the bottom right "�1937 NATIONAL COMMITTEE FOR ART APPRECIATION". Back has two small holes in the top corners from previous hanging. |
